What Are Manual Org Chart Templates?

Static visuals made in software such as PowerPoint, Google Slides, or Excel are called manual organization chart templates. They have a low learning curve and no need for special tools or training. Just drag the shapes around, type the names, connect the lines, and export as a PDF.

Of course, when organizations expand, the use of manual templates becomes a very difficult task to manage. A new employee, a promotion, or a reorganization demand manual edits, which very often end up causing outdated versions and formatting chaos. What starts as a simple task becomes hours of re-alignment and cleaning up.

Common tools for manual templates:

  • PowerPoint or Slides: Simple layouts but hard to maintain once changes occur.
  • Excel or Sheets: Easy data management but poor visual hierarchy control.
  • Design tools (Figma, Illustrator): Perfect for visual polish but complex for HR or admin teams.

Manual charts serve as one-time visuals—not ongoing management tools.

When Manual Templates Work Well

A dynamic tool is not a necessity for all the organizations immediately. There are still situations where manual templates are more applicable. If the company is small or undergoing infrequent changes, then it is alright to do manual org chart since it is a perfectly efficient method.

  • Small teams with fixed roles: Up to 20-30 employees with low turnover and no major changes.
  • One-time presentations: Suitable for board decks or project proposals where a quick view is all you need.
  • Design show: If you require exact control and intend to export your chart for print or pitch decks.

Manual templates are basic, cheap, and adaptable but only fit for organizations with little growth or change.

Why Manual Templates Become a Problem

As soon as your company starts scaling, static templates can’t keep up. The lack of real-time collaboration leads to outdated information, version confusion, and wasted effort trying to merge edits.

  • Version sprawl: Everyone edits their own file, and no one knows which is final.
  • Formatting frustration: Adding a new hire misaligns the layout, forcing hours of manual rearranging.
  • Outdated data: Old exports circulate in emails and chats long after structures have changed.
  • Limited accessibility: New employees can’t easily access or trust the chart’s accuracy.

In growing companies, structure changes are constant—manual templates simply can’t handle the pace.

What Is an Online Org Chart Maker?

An online org chart maker is a web-based platform that lets you create, edit, and share org charts collaboratively. Tools like Cloudairy’s Org Chart Maker automatically handle spacing, connections, and visual formatting while allowing multiple people to edit simultaneously.

The result is a living document that stays accurate, visually consistent, and instantly shareable. Instead of attaching a file, you send a link. Everyone sees the same, up-to-date chart—no confusion, no duplicates.

Key features of online org chart makers:

  • Drag-and-drop editing: Add or remove people and departments instantly.
  • Real-time collaboration: Multiple users can work together on the same chart.
  • Automatic layout: The software adjusts connectors and spacing automatically.
  • Custom branding: Use company colors, fonts, and logos for professional presentation.

Online org charts aren’t just prettier—they’re smarter, faster, and built for modern collaboration.

Best Practices for Maintaining an Online Org Chart

Even with an online tool, structure only stays clear if you maintain it proactively. Follow these habits for best results:

  • Update regularly: Review charts quarterly or after each hiring phase to reflect changes.
  • Assign ownership: HR or department leads should be responsible for edits.
  • Keep it accessible: Share the link in onboarding docs or employee portals.
  • Simplify visuals: Use consistent shapes and colors to avoid clutter and confusion.

These habits ensure your chart remains accurate, useful, and trusted by everyone.
